일단, RTKit에 대해 설명해야 겠군요. M1부터 애플은 로직보드에 존재하는 모든 코프로세서들(M1에는 열개 넘게 달려있다고)을 위한 RTKit이라는 RTOS를 만들고, 이 칩들과 메인 프로세서 간의 통신 인터페이스도 작성해놨습니다.
iOS 15로 넘어가면서 전원을 꺼도 이 기능이 작동되게 되었습니다. 또한 BLE 광고 기능등 말이죠...
간단합니다. RTKit등을 이용해서 잠시 필요할때만 잠시 켜두고 끄는거죠...
그래서 아마 이것에 대한 공격이 나오지 않을까 싶습니다. 현재 이 기능을 사용할수 있는 아이폰은 11, 12, 13입니다.
미국등 이 기능이 활성화된 곳은 좋겠지만, 한국은 이를 지원하지 않기 때문에... 그냥 빛좋은 개살구죠...
몰랐는데 아이폰 들 때 화면이 켜지는거나 시리도 RTKit 위에서 돌아가는군요. 그걸로 배터리 효율을 높일 수 있었나 봅니다